About Chuan Wang
Chuan Wang is a scholar working on Metals and Alloys, Industrial and Manufacturing Engineering and Building and Construction, having authored 50 papers that have together received 838 indexed citations. Recurring topics across this work include Corrosion Behavior and Inhibition (9 papers), Recycling and utilization of industrial and municipal waste in materials production (7 papers) and Hydrogen embrittlement and corrosion behaviors in metals (6 papers). The work is most often cited by research in Metals and Alloys (54 citations), Water Science and Technology (287 citations) and Industrial and Manufacturing Engineering (134 citations). Chuan Wang has collaborated with scholars based in China, United States and Sweden. Frequent co-authors include Chengchun Jiang, Hong Liu, Huanan Cui, Juan Xiao, Yangming Lei, Zhenyao Wang, Yani Hua, Qinqin Zhang, C.Y. Cui and Fu-Shen Zhang. Their work appears in journals such as SHILAP Revista de lepidopterología, Environmental Science & Technology and Journal of Hazardous Materials.
